From 0a9e410a05ed92df355005cae1d3e82404bd26ef Mon Sep 17 00:00:00 2001 From: Tibor Frank Date: Fri, 26 Jan 2024 09:50:42 +0000 Subject: [PATCH] C-Dash: Add bandwidth to MRR iterative Change-Id: I86e4322796a47c952b3b248419b01a7fa2da12c7 Signed-off-by: Tibor Frank --- .../app/cdash/data/_metadata/iterative_rls2402_mrr | Bin 7919 -> 10179 bytes csit.infra.dash/app/cdash/data/data.yaml | 8 ++++---- csit.infra.dash/app/cdash/report/graphs.py | 5 ++--- 3 files changed, 6 insertions(+), 7 deletions(-) diff --git a/csit.infra.dash/app/cdash/data/_metadata/iterative_rls2402_mrr b/csit.infra.dash/app/cdash/data/_metadata/iterative_rls2402_mrr index 96832850b1c89b5d9d3339b6e031510fb6b539df..416679acdbc5fa6fe0aa38b99b81832cfed7324a 100644 GIT binary patch literal 10179 zcmd5?-E!N;73MgK)26=aL>+m?ZC$pRb|!WNf}(6@db6NRkc>o$v;~0hWHk6A2?_vN z0{r#(4f;NPmtOTja?x{k0TLiUiE?Z?9E-y49-Q;-`P;Kcz98+w{@&xCAD40m4}GI= zx!V3ea{G_IeQ@x_V5onaJAIPNvGJGs#CFX1%x}y|a1|^@R($ezI61Y(zCHA!`8{Cw zwI66>Ah%uX+iy<){re}+fHAPn!P>)-=KGe(n=h%L*|A3*`vjfXzkAKPHp=+Kwv(2D?wF3Uvo9SZc^EXo_xA3={iFexv`o?dm zjW$icx3IKvWOF3@(j9t1KR)w?sV&0sA99Z$J${C^_e{+{`0v5HyzQCR{K^d#F%G?Us zCb@KN%Q3H#a|{-BZ!! zY>_QCw)k-+uM=EaaB^)!E;x;ac@bap63!K^93Q>){GV_==42`3vMibwzMkI@tPh7y zS}4w1ns=MDFioe$#TGW?Z4IK`oHu5`2J zI#N-cg)>ny?1nV;$_Cb$(H7VheeYndw-O9t-Edt1G9uTUdzy9?6joeiL$z(dz6 zU3=YKkgng_!1_^qbyXIoeKN7MA=`ihus0mrhL&+0*>Y0gq6}?4kI;{GJ zW78U2ST1%o$G6@mDj%#()2O1^&j5(l#%V;W>CXTOit{v}aPpqu(1LwzX~A$z>uAT; z$J%&-W%OvFjmN_oB8(1vm@V+%bKe*8VC#GcF}8?n#r*r+!6VXcpUXe68}7mXxI_GK znN{^fq(jh{N)Cn1~`Bsa(3MpXy3?Bs&tyfwnYz*I&imq1((zOWu20nyn zWCq_Y_z^Uuw-$|&?zSDPS{~^9yr9daWqmO0$wlARcxR$k>c{m;W6_aIp8C4(!}Fvg z7aXL~J;~QAvtHe6avi0?;oMm`){DeGx5@mpLTsbhb`0cmQY|a5f!=LS^_mpuPMOIT zrIk$Gtp*_HxGt6ox;R65t|m*qS}kYD75ad^ZxqU$r3e&L-IFGo+?=Z7rH!%yV_?*r zu32+tly9Xm?YJYSQ*5zyS>if!yKjoG0I%?(?n;vmU%u90zqp^eBVD#_?x^k+lGwd7 zq}M@zD_nJVH0{__M=8v)wHfI0x}!AXmX23<_WB>oVJ?T9deF-_&=+>O>W*%V-XDValZu+9>izQ!dOb zDeePJ&TzqZ7j*A|3VH$_TxaE1^YUp0ZM`X1bqudL()lC0C)ITvU2Jz_I=wcPcGq;J zg~2;ho!R=n?70M+FHnCP#@`nGfuHmZ4={=j#u3^+3m^Ip_|S?5?6sjoh$~Z+sI2Co zt?ORXWHNX1y&3rTQk7YZW#}=nZe-ZFB$(*_B{`BP_f1QKk0CH@X1>- zfqz`9N@rW_-|77{?F{yp19~^___w-qNyYKQHd0tSJGivLsed(gJG^@eN&y=wC zN$1J3t$~l5%%(e?H8Azqu|=(PYL`6VFFaFE*e)t@`Y2O4ssG$8+ad`2y>AIO`OC%?EQ- zbdLhQa6UC0dM6Vx2R5CqlB)Yls$5+#+3CDt$x`3gUbhbLj8^$F+%=m0?e&*4F;99~ zbwAeB1zjq~_^`X(8NK&GEg?!!PqgsvC=SOX~SDfq`Ry-SLY4Yl6F!g~|kBP{SM!z~wCu3guy zcqco1Q=gnwj^=d_{4sv#Sl^X^M}2WRAd|C2qYSMF5q?M%>+neX9}@l&dR0PBhS1v} z6YN#gX3)?OS~zat_@W1`i^>dJ85*`XXzK&UJwjA$a|k_Xcbv44RKi}!1@=5D9rz+| z@Qe08$ThZJU?2!>?1vBzzd$g2=$Jmyc8S>TTPRE_6Gfg_s*5gejEV)LnGAxj`pgYA42GWAaJoki0@UE z*$Y9irYU_AFcs{82kSC?L3jiF%Jq`j`xdKbf%G-z1NdDb^<{+j zBpWYP`gZ>c^@sNf#6YS#aAx-5E?$KGbxEB{qy%gK5~zQzay^+N{o#iGAUVKi?e7rB zpp;cVg`89Ty>LH*(5FH+Emrz36r suZa~rH%6o98vfzpY50eUr}R%2+~c3Wf&W|g!T)mq`Fk#R0snpP|H`z`IRF3v literal 7919 zcmd5>TXWmS73MgK)24ptG*w5QaZ?Rv+!xy+36ZjxX&;t15R62Nw1t}|qrr_NC;+4Y zkQC+7Kge(CpX%SpL(ka-NRS{)sd1HHBnZ1_an85rzR)@87WVg^|NKoUbMQ1U29~Ss zA7=KSy?k=;#c-s*%$&Z+WZ3viePTOia^`pDB)kmgV=FoN2b`Q*eqfKhczzGqeI10F z56f-Wdim$mpZ@gXH82L&8K6BKYe8U{OwL!K6@-`eilndB7=8^ez3{DI;)IvJWmxvq zy7aX$x@psXW*?V)yLCwrn%0!b`|H+46VDE#EtH-d{B7&Hspd?qVE@Vf)6;*zmP&gE zdyXB1`%f5(Jv+2qChPZfZ|f@Cn_HS6>k3u>r91M%L2~8`Q=3QQzhs_2d;S`A=9yY> z@UL$^Wo^&2ZZ3_HGjY8j`~Bg^PuVM&gQu*od3`JU`Y`Kht_2g`#BpFmjRC_veIAYB zu|OX!`gr#v3>d#l%G`?Bu5#(wmSbM7&M{cjEl@t_&={Ev!NeWU7le^Mw2TmuxmKu| zTByPDPg%=@<+j(ycP~CP-kfCb5@1$QWWhs`!3vCc^1e8N&_{8rI8aM>uK`Z9w=DJj zw5-MS=am-6Ra#(@^7&;(QMOrZg7|qQFB3yr@G5OhE;x;a`2=6{R-7xQ92Y-&!H-B! zI9bZLEc>K|FXz_;>!XpA7K*c$=IxRerMI-W1Yu3y)*!l{^Cm2}8Y&6G=aslMRYGb` zZ+zG4HEca+q=m=Dv;h)?|7Py3;%HHL0KCQe#{!52=>hoSP4wdBU&M?$u=OV^hdsJXd6P@_QDfnmvAqr5fk?^ev8&g ztfV8~w0sLoa8Gjr>u#l*V7*VHif4ZXK(yaTBU()V3Xq`TNdt-|9|;a^f_zI0M?URM z99#D_e~zumc&_>WXod*mBnq~5%N#r--R?W-d)93q{Pg!6 zUU~A45YmBPynZ00NGg5OAf!*KeL7dEtk7pTSzplKby{o;cgls*1wv*7-h;o$qGs$GU4!exlgrPe1hS-Wqme4(l5s z=r6`afN$AmI$Fn^pm`P0CFrY=z~qS&O=?e7*aPYZ_8uBdr)M^u8SLYj>af|Om?&Km z^NQ3Rn0$Ro*KI^Uu4jQ>TCUOR7~@60#okuMc={-%6d zMgLmrM{SDv*jBg?)pZ=5@Ah=J5k~vGGUaZ(Z?xY`0UuQ4c07l=DCn+(Hj4eRpv#p~ z%olwC{BaJx>#@BT9FuPVkM3aMSIvBYwob`)#ks*bQ{AR}ay3Z|)J8d>({90RlsQ#y z-D*;KLis>>_T$>A3EjqHW>G^&-G_VoYA#k(=N4d@@lTc*c!t=+8?bpXAN12ueGjR`clotL=S z&${L|o9SHZ8hkvm>Ah+VyCcodw~AtYMTufwBL*miC}|jYY4stb}P@ZF9Tl;G^qu(rB%W)^erWLp6f@fP9*9i z^nk+6nO&Tn4(m4hW1`1d_GZXqC``_(#aqG4!+}SE-%6Cj&Z0vQspDB_PGH>X*I;r4 z$0c%#V?tnDyTD`9H6EXMQiVAM#|1og@$?ua;8|;gtLyQ33`pm2p2K11;sQx+yjAF- z3|@>clu<$3kO^H+-v^oTRRbm`IH;gt(zrdz<;n&g6>+Z8MSk=ohv?v<{OJ=F#WTOf z33wlf{pcJ>HwLrpEu>$>cuAd3`scT~+%f!8`Sk`ILScWDKRt;usW^#>AjFcyfk7$2 z6oi93dM*VL1GR*P%gK069yveC)+^^ ziM|Er=4c)JOZ5x6iad&gEVyxgOJRjoAwwC(<$%9pJc$teQLf0Zx%_ z3XqS;HSVu`3;fZZ^%~^_hkG30ja>-3GKPE@(y{RN6iOH)pXko0cP>-|Q0V@5 z;=x)?_tQXr`C-IA!oxgoiKkLTJUeSK^vsZBA+{=~k-rFJxWIe1882>dxBjq4q^c07 zz#4VluXS?p3{T(>l!QSY*@uq7u7oUdMZZ?Z^{*CqE+`)GGq~s@eFA?2Jd6IHyv6nN zIR5JVW_v~XL~h@z67Z^g0FY$?ZWLd2Kv`emJrOVPU560%y#&s=yc4Pn20()N>|+Sf zt44%{{05Ux{dZ{}g05I$=jHee(XSLyz8}X|hwYatC9z)`4?I1~((fWv;tz;Fr{E14 zZ_zJJ1<|(ySXMj3^#BU;9K{c!D9+Au)Ab1dy1&!>cdc`fGH4u7Mf@{!a5&cd>xmV< nF~;LJ8h&Iuj6R|r($8!8=Rf}u{wMvQpUl6%&1BBuU)}!!w{P2< diff --git a/csit.infra.dash/app/cdash/data/data.yaml b/csit.infra.dash/app/cdash/data/data.yaml index a20332630a..16f8dda694 100644 --- a/csit.infra.dash/app/cdash/data/data.yaml +++ b/csit.infra.dash/app/cdash/data/data.yaml @@ -346,10 +346,10 @@ - result_receive_rate_rate_stdev - result_receive_rate_rate_unit - result_receive_rate_rate_values - # - result_receive_rate_bandwidth_avg - # - result_receive_rate_bandwidth_stdev - # - result_receive_rate_bandwidth_unit - # - result_receive_rate_bandwidth_values + - result_receive_rate_bandwidth_avg + - result_receive_rate_bandwidth_stdev + - result_receive_rate_bandwidth_unit + - result_receive_rate_bandwidth_values - data_type: iterative partition: test_type partition_name: ndrpdr diff --git a/csit.infra.dash/app/cdash/report/graphs.py b/csit.infra.dash/app/cdash/report/graphs.py index 175de0f759..50a3be287a 100644 --- a/csit.infra.dash/app/cdash/report/graphs.py +++ b/csit.infra.dash/app/cdash/report/graphs.py @@ -159,8 +159,7 @@ def graph_iterative(data: pd.DataFrame, sel:dict, layout: dict, ) } - if itm["testtype"] == "mrr": - # and itm["rls"] in ("rls2306", "rls2310"): + if itm["testtype"] == "mrr" and itm["rls"] in ("rls2306", "rls2310"): trial_run = "trial" metadata["csit-ref"] = ( f"{itm_data['job'].to_list()[0]}/", @@ -188,7 +187,7 @@ def graph_iterative(data: pd.DataFrame, sel:dict, layout: dict, ) tput_traces.append(go.Box(**tput_kwargs)) - if ttype in ("ndr", "pdr"): + if ttype in ("ndr", "pdr", "mrr"): y_band, y_band_max = get_y_values( itm_data, y_band_max, -- 2.16.6